Understanding Coarse Hair
Coarse hair is characterized by its thick, rough texture that can often feel dry and unmanageable. This hair type is usually caused by genetics, but external factors such as heat styling, chemical treatments, and environmental damage can exacerbate its coarseness. Understanding the unique properties of coarse hair is the first step towards achieving softer, silkier locks.

Common Causes Of Coarse Hair
Excessive heat styling, such as the frequent use of flat irons or curling wands, can strip the hair of its natural moisture, resulting in a coarse and brittle texture. Chemical treatments like perming or relaxing can also cause damage to the hair, leading to a coarser appearance.

Step 1: Choosing The Right Shampoo And Conditioner
When it comes to coarse hair, opt for hydrate. Look for shampoos and conditioners that are free from sulfates and contain nourishing ingredients like argan oil, shea butter, or coconut oil.
When shampooing, please focus on the scalp to remove any dirt or buildup, and gently massage the shampoo into your hair without roughing it up.
Follow up with a rich, hydrating conditioner,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ends of your hair. Leave the conditioner on for a few minutes before rinsing to allow it to penetrate and moisturize the hair.

Step 3: Using The Right Styling Products
Choosing the right styling products can make a difference in achieving soft and silky locks. Look for products specifically formulated for coarse hair, such as smoothing serums, leave-in conditioners, or hair oils. Shine and enhance manageability.
When applying styling products, start with a small amount and gradually add more if needed. Work the product through your hair,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ends, and avoid applying too close to the roots, as this can weigh the hair down. For added protection against heat styling, opt for products that offer heat protection benefits.

Step 6: Protective Hairstyles for Coarse Hair
These hairstyles involve keeping the ends of the hair tucked away and protected, reducing the risk of breakage and damage from external factors.
Popular protective hairstyles for coarse hair include braids, twists, buns, and updos. These styles not only protect the hair but also allow for easier maintenance and less manipulation, which can further contribute to the health and softness of the hair. Additionally, wearing a silk or satin scarf or bonnet while sleeping can help preserve moisture and prevent friction and breakage.
